Cayman Islands domiciled reinsurance company, Topsail Re, will be added to Mutual Re’s ownership group effective January 1st, 2026, joining Farm Bureau Mutual Insurance Company of Michigan, Kentucky Farm Bureau Mutual Insurance Company, Motorists Mutual Insurance Company (Encova Mutual Insurance Group), and Mutual Assurance Society of Virginia.

Effective January 1st, 2026, Mutual Re will remain well capitalized with more than $5 billion of combined policyholder surplus among its five assuming companies.
